What Happened on January 13?
2012 – The cruise ship Costa Concordia sinks, killing 32
The ship's captain was later accused of imprudence, negligence, and incompetence.
2001 – An earthquake devastates El Salvador
This quake killed nearly 1000 people; at least 315 people feel victim to a second quake on February 13, 2001.
2000 – Bill Gates steps down as CEO of Microsoft
Gates co-founded Microsoft in 1975 together with Paul Allen.
1968 – Johnny Cash performs live at Folsom State Prison
The album “Johnny Cash at Folsom Prison” became a huge success.
1915 – The worst earthquake in Italian history kills 30,000
The quake hit the town of Avezzano, about 100 km (60 m) east of Rome.
